码界工坊

htykm.cn
人生若只如初见

热血传奇私服轻变

热血传奇私服轻变_热血传奇私服轻变轻变_刚开一秒传奇私服

随着数字媒体技术的发展,视频在我们生活中扮演着越来越重要的角色,从社交媒体到在线教育、远程会议甚至到医疗保健,视频已经成为了人们传递信息和沟通的主要方式之一。然而,高质量视频造成的数据流量和存储需求正在日益增长,这对网络带宽和存储资源提出了巨大挑战。因此,视频压缩成为了解决这些问题的一个关键领域。

视频压缩简单来说就是通过优化数据编码算法,将原始视频信号转换为可被网络传输或存储的小文件。这可以大大减少需要的带宽和存储空间,并在视频传输和播放时提供更快的速度和更好的用户体验。最常见的视频压缩标准包括H.264/AVC、H.265/HEVC、VP9等。

H.264/AVC是一种广泛使用的视频压缩标准,其以高压缩比和良好的视觉质量而闻名。该标准利用了多种方法来降低视频数据的比特率,如运动估计、变换编码和熵编码等。其中,运动估计是一种基于时间和空间相关性的技术,它通过比较相邻帧之间的差异来识别图像中的动态部分,从而生成运动矢量,以描述物体的运动轨迹。变换编码使用离散余弦变换(DCT)将视频信号转换为频率域中的系数,然后通过量化和熵编码来减少数据的存储量。H.264/AVC的高效性得益于所有这些技术的完美组合,并且已经被广泛应用于各种场景。

尽管 H.264/AVC 取得了显著进展,但是随着视频质量需求增加和技术的不断发展,该标准仍然存在一些挑战。为了更好地解决这些问题,新的视频压缩标准应运而生,例如 H.265/HEVC 和 VP9。H.265/HEVC 是一个面向未来的标准,它比 H.264/AVC 计算复杂度更高,但提供了更高的压缩比和视觉质量。同样,VP9 也是一个具有挑战性的视频压缩标准,由 Google 开发并用于 YouTube 等流媒体服务。VP9 利用了类似于 H.264/AVC 的技术,包括预测、变换和熵编码,但也引入了一些新技术,如分层结构、运动估计和扩展位深度。此外,VP9 还支持 Google Hardware Video Codec(GHVC),这是一种硬件加速的视频编码器,可以通过 GPU 来实现更快的编解码速度。

总之,随着数字媒体技术的不断进步和需求的不断增长,视频压缩将继续成为一个重要的领域。H.264/AVC、H.265/HEVC 和 VP9 等标准都为视频压缩做出了巨大贡献,并且新的技术和算法正在不断涌现。未来,我们有理由相信,这个领域将继续取得进一步的发展。

未经允许不得转载 » 本文链接:http://htykm.cn/hao/729c4299228.html

推荐文章

  • Debian版Jenkins如何配置邮件通知

    在Debian版Jenkins中配置邮件通知可以通过以下步骤完成:安装邮件插件首先,需要安装Email Extension Plugin插件。可以通过Jenkins管理界面的“系统管理” - “插件管 ...

  • Ubuntu更新后如何清理旧版本

    在Ubuntu更新后,可以通过以下步骤来清理旧版本的软件缓存、日志以及不再使用的孤立软件包,以释放磁盘空间并保持系统的整洁。清理Journal日志检查日志大小:使用 journalctl --disk ...

  • Linux驱动怎样调试更高效

    在Linux环境下进行驱动程序调试时,可以采用以下几种方法来提高调试效率:使用printk()函数:printk()是Linux内核中用于打印调试信息的函数,类似于C语言中的printf()。通过在驱 ...

  • 怎样进行Linux Informix故障排查

    在进行Linux Informix故障排查时,可以遵循以下步骤:一、收集信息查看错误日志:检查Informix的错误日志文件,通常位于/opt/informix/errlog或/var/log/inf ...

  • Linux yum如何管理软件组

    在Linux系统中,YUMYellowdog Updater, Modified)是一个用于管理RPM包的工具。通过YUM,你可以轻松地安装、更新、卸载和管理软件包。此外,YUM还允许你管理软件组,这 ...

  • centos防火墙如何修改规则

    在CentOS系统中,您可以使用firewall-cmd命令来修改防火墙规则。以下是一些基本步骤:查看当前防火墙状态:sudo firewall-cmd --state查看所有开放的端口:sudo f ...

  • Ubuntu iptables如何设置定时任务

    在 Ubuntu 系统中,使用 iptables设置定时任务通常涉及以下几个步骤:创建iptables规则:首先,你需要确定要应用的iptables规则。这些规则可以用于限制流量、允许特定IP访问等。 ...

  • Linux readdir在多线程中如何工作

    readdir是一个用于读取目录内容的函数,它在 Linux 系统中被广泛使用。在多线程环境中使用 readdir时,需要注意以下几点:线程安全:readdir函数本身是线程安全的,这意味着你可以在多 ...